Isaac Leeser Tanakh - Isaiah - Isaiah 1

Isaiah 1:25-31

25And I will turn my hand against thee, and purge away as with lye thy dross, and remove all thy tin:
26And I will restore thy judges as at the first, and thy counsellors as at the beginning; after that shalt thou be called, The city of righteousness, the town that is faithful.
27Zion shall be redeemed through justice, and her converts through righteousness.
28But destruction shall come over transgressors and sinners together, and those that forsake the Lord shall perish.
29For people shall be ashamed because of the terebinths which ye had desired, and ye shall be put to the blush because of the gardens that ye had chosen.
30For ye shall be as a terebinth the leaves of which wither, and as a garden that hath no water.
31And the mighty oppressor shall become as tow, and his workman as a spark; and they shall both burn together, with none to quench.
